A charming detached stone-built cottage and bothy with exceptional coastal views.

The Old School is a characterful detached property offering unique accommodation across two levels within an enviable setting with far-reaching views to Strathy Bay. The versatile property comes complete with a stone-built bothy and walled garden.

The entrance hall with its half wood panelled and painted stone walls sits alongside a useful store room. Further is a cosy sitting room area with bespoke fitted shelving, opening to the spacious open-plan living, dining area and kitchen. The striking space with its tall vaulted ceiling and mezzanine above has a handsome fireplace, exposed stone walls, with ample natural light and impressive views via picture windows of the beachfront and bay. There is plenty of space for dining and French doors opening to the south-facing terrace, whilst the kitchen comprises a range of modern cabinetry along with a handy walk-in pantry. Adjacent is a shower room.

The galleried mezzanine first floor with its glass balustraded walkway enjoys stunning elevated aspects and an airy feel, comprising a bedroom with fitted wardrobes and a seating area with an excellent vantage point.

Outside

The property benefits from an elevated position enjoying views to the rolling hills and the dramatic coastline. It is approached via a gravelled driveway and gate opening to the front terrace ideal for al fresco dining. From here is the walled garden and the charming bothy. Adjacent is an expanse of lawn with various shrubs enclosed via stone walls.

Situation

The picturesque village of Strathy boasts an award-winning beach, café and public house and sits a short distance from Melvich with its shop, Post Office, primary school and restaurant. Thurso is within easy reach, offering a wide range of further amenities. There is an airport and hospital in Wick, with convenient road and rail links via the A9 and Forsinard Station. Inverness offers a comprehensive range of facilities as would be expected from the main business and commercial centre in the Highlands.
